partman-efi mostly disables itself if not booted under EFI
(https://git.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/partman-
efi/tree/init.d/efi?h=ubuntu/groovy#n15), I think that's why the
partition type doesn't get set and why the partition doesn't get
formatted. I'm not sure what the consequence of simply not checking that
would be.
Also, I think grub-installer needs to grow a way to override archdetect
(maybe just ARCH="${ARCH:-$(archdetect)}" or whatever) and ubiquity
needs to call it twice.
IOW this is a fair bit of work.
